Lemma: קָטָן

Transliterashon: kaw-tawn'

Definishon: or qaton; from קוּט; abbreviated, i.e. diminutive, literally (in quantity, size or number) or figuratively (in age or importance)

KJV Definishon: least, less(-er), little (one), small(-est, one, quantity, thing), young(-er, -est)
